When the fresh fruit aisle seems to be struggling in February, lemons offer a welcome pop of color and flavor until the warmth of spring swoops in. They're one of the most versatile fruits available, with infinite uses in both sweet and savory recipes and beyond. Originating in Asia, lemons served as a staple in medicine and holistic healing, as they contain antiseptic and antibacterial properties.

A very low pH level makes the lemon useful as a household cleaning aid. I like to make use of juiced lemons by rubbing them in my sink and then running them through the disposal to remove any unwanted odors. Lemons are also great for removing stains and stubborn smells from wood countertops, cutting boards, and wooden utensils.

A splash of lemon can brighten a sauce, veggie, protein, or dessert, adding a piquant bite. We've compiled our favorite lemon recipes to help you take advantage of lemon season.
